Hi,

I've clonned a database to another server and copied over the attachments from the original environment under /home/odoo/.local/share/Odoo/filestore on the new environment. So far so good, the old attachments are visible from the clonned application, but when I try to create new attachments these are simply not stored in the corresponding OS-ubuntu 14.04 folder and I get the following error message:

OSError: [Errno 2] No such file or directory

The attachment referenced in the error message has actually not been created. The 'document' addon is installed in the system.

Do you have some kind of guide or steps to follow to clone an environment attachments included?

Thanks in advance.

777 can be a not-so-good temporary solution. Check if the user who is running the instance (i.e. "odoo" ) has enough right to read/write the file. This is what you will need. For example, 755 should be good. Of course, owner of the share should be that user. Perhaps you copied as root, and this is the problem.
